Hexagram 48: The Well Changing to Hexagram 22: Grace

I Ching casting meaning · JingBi

Depth is putting on a jacket — The Well is passing into Grace, where the source that has been quietly reliable now needs to be presented with clarity and beauty. The water is real; now the well itself — its appearance, its accessibility, its story — needs attention. Polish the presentation: make the well inviting, legible, easy to approach. Just remember: Grace is the finish, not the fuel. A beautifully designed well with no water is a garden ornament. A well with deep water and an ugly, inaccessible rim serves fewer people than it could. Grace after depth amplifies the service. Grace without depth is a decoration. Make the well beautiful because the water deserves a beautiful access. Not the other way around.

A casting that moves from The Well into Grace means the situation you asked about is not static — it begins as one pattern and resolves into another. The first hexagram describes where you stand; the second describes where events are carrying you.

The situation: Hexagram 48, The Well

The well doesn't move. Deep value serves everyone who draws.

Water raised from deep in the earth by wood and rope — the well: the one thing in town that never moves and never runs dry, the source everyone depends on. This hexagram is about deep, shared, renewable value. Two instructions ride on it. First, tend the source — maintain your core skills, your health, the thing you draw from, because a neglected well silts up. Second, finish the job: value that never gets delivered helps no one. Be the reliable source, and complete what you start. Depth plus follow-through is the whole formula.

Structurally, The Well is Wind below Water — the inner state meeting the outer condition. That pairing is the lens for everything above.

Where it's heading: Hexagram 22, Grace

Beauty in form. Polish matters, but substance carries the load.

The changed hexagram is the trajectory, not a verdict. As the moving lines settle, the energy of The Well gives way to Grace (Bi) — Fire below Mountain. The advice that belongs to this outcome: Polish the presentation, but fix the substance first. Form amplifies, never replaces.
